Benefits of Non-Invasive Medical Devices
Non-invasive medical devices provide numerous benefits to both patients and Healthcare Providers. Some of the key advantages include:
- Improved patient outcomes: Non-invasive devices reduce the risk of complications, infections, and other adverse events associated with invasive procedures. This leads to better patient outcomes and higher satisfaction rates.
- Cost savings: Non-invasive procedures are typically less expensive than invasive surgeries, as they require fewer resources and shorter hospital stays. This can help reduce Healthcare Costs for both patients and providers.
- Increased efficiency: Non-invasive devices allow for faster and more accurate diagnosis and treatment, leading to shorter wait times, reduced bottlenecks, and improved Workflow in healthcare facilities.
Challenges in Implementing Non-Invasive Medical Devices
While the benefits of non-invasive medical devices are clear, there are also challenges associated with their implementation in hospital supply and equipment management:
- Cost: Non-invasive devices can be expensive to purchase and maintain, requiring healthcare facilities to invest significant resources upfront. This can be a barrier for some hospitals, especially smaller facilities with limited budgets.
- Training and expertise: Healthcare Providers must be properly trained to use non-invasive devices effectively. This requires ongoing education and support, which can strain hospital resources and staff time.
- Integration with existing systems: Non-invasive devices must be seamlessly integrated into a hospital's Supply Chain and equipment management systems. This may require upgrades to existing infrastructure and processes, which can be time-consuming and complex.
Impact on Hospital Supply and Equipment Management
The emergence of non-invasive medical devices has had a significant impact on hospital supply and equipment management in the United States. Some of the key effects include:
- Increased demand for non-invasive devices: As Healthcare Providers recognize the benefits of non-invasive technologies, the demand for these devices is growing. Hospitals must adapt their Supply Chain to ensure they have an adequate stock of non-invasive devices to meet patient needs.
- Improved inventory management: Non-invasive devices require careful inventory management to prevent shortages or excess stock. Hospitals must develop efficient systems for tracking, ordering, and storing these devices to ensure they are always available when needed.
- Enhanced preventative maintenance: Non-invasive devices are complex pieces of equipment that require regular maintenance to function properly. Hospitals must implement comprehensive preventative maintenance programs to ensure their devices are in good working order and to prevent costly breakdowns.
